John Boos “Pro-Bowl” 2-Compartment Sink with 18" Left Drainboard
Model 42PB1618-1D18L • 14 GA Type 300 Stainless SteelEngineered for the daily demands of commercial kitchens, this John Boos Pro-Bowl sink delivers rock-solid performance, food-safe sanitation, and ergonomic workflow in one compact 54" footprint.
Why You’ll Love It
- Premium 14-gauge, Type 300 stainless steel resists dents, corrosion and chemicals.
- Two generous 16" × 18" × 12" deep bowls handle prep, wash or rinse tasks simultaneously.
- Integrated 18" left-side drainboard keeps clean or soiled wares organized and off your worktop.
- 10" boxed backsplash with 2" 45° return helps contain splashes and protects walls.
- Pre-drilled 8" on-center splash-mount faucet holes speed installation.
- Die-stamped 3-1/2" drain openings accept industry-standard basket strainers.
- Stainless steel legs, adjustable side/front bracing, and 1" bullet feet level the sink on uneven floors.
- NSF & CSA-Sanitation listed for worry-free code compliance.
Technical Specifications
Overall dimensions | 54-3/16" W × 23-1/2" D × 44-1/16" H |
---|---|
Bowl (each) | 16" W × 18" front-to-back × 12" deep |
Drainboard | 18" L (left side) |
Backsplash height | 10" with 2" return & 45° top |
Faucet mounting | (1) set of 8" O.C. splash-mount holes, 1" dia. |
Material & finish | 14 GA Type 300 stainless, #4 satin polish |
Legs / bracing | 1-5/8" Ø SS legs & 1-1/4" Ø SS bracing, KD |
Feet | 1" adjustable stainless bullet feet |
Certifications | NSF, CSA-Sanitation |
Shipping weight | ≈ 94 lb |
Built for Busy Back-of-House
Every weld is TIG-finished and blended for a smooth, snag-free surface that wipes clean in seconds. 5/8" coved corners speed sanitation while bull-nosed outside edges protect staff and equipment from sharp corners. Care & Maintenance Tips
- Clean daily with non-chloride, non-abrasive cleaners such as Bar Keepers Friend.
- Always scrub and wipe dry in the direction of the grain to maintain the protective film.
- Avoid steel wool, wire brushes, or chlorine bleach to prevent scratching and pitting.
- Apply John Boos Stainless Steel Cleaner periodically for a like-new shine.
Following these guidelines preserves the chromium-oxide layer that keeps stainless steel rust-free.
